I was taken by this young woman teaching her child how to use a mobile phone (we all do it but the contrast here was very strong to my eyes). Up in some remote villages in the mountains of North Vietnam and down forgotten valleys, in the middle of ethnic communities, it may be difficult to find a good meal or clean water, but technology has arrived even there. I remember that some villagers told me I was the first white man they saw live and the first one to get there, but they had internet and mobile phones so they knew what to expect... the contrast between the living conditions and the available technology was quite incredible and children are prompt into it.
